Ingredients for Crispy Dill Pickle Parmesan Chicken
Gather the following ingredients for an unforgettable meal:
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ts: Choose fresh, high-quality chicken for the best texture.
- 1 cup dill pickle juice: Brines the chicken and infuses it with flavor. You can also use homemade pickle juice with fresh dill.
- 1 cup seasoned breadcrumbs: Offers that crunch. You can substitute with panko for an even crispier texture.
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ese: The star of the crust, lending its nutty flavor. You can replace this with Pecorino Romano if desired.
- 1/2 cup all-purpose flour: Creates a barrier that helps the egg and breadcrumb mixture stick.
- 2 large eggs, whisked: Acts as the glue for the crumb coating.
- 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, 1/2 tsp paprika, salt and pepper to taste: These spices elevate the flavors beautifully. Use fresh spices for an extra punch!
- Cooking oil for frying: Vegetable oil works well, but you can also use canola or peanut oil for higher heat tolerance.
How to Make Crispy Dill Pickle Parmesan Chicken
-
Marinate the Chicken: Place chicken breasts in a shallow dish or zip-top bag. Pour the dill pickle juice over the chicken, ensuring that it is fully submerged. Allow it to marinate in the refrigerator for 30 minutes to up to 2 hours—this step infuses the chicken with flavor and juiciness.
-
Set Up Your Dredging Stations: Create three shallow dishes for an easy assembly line:
- In the first dish, mix the flour with gar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, salt, and pepper.
- In the second, whisk the two large eggs until well blended.
- In the third dish, combine the seasoned breadcrumbs with grated Parmesan cheese.
-
Dredge the Chicken: Remove chicken from the brine and pat dry with paper towels. First, coat each piece in the flour mixture, shaking off any excess. Dip the floured chicken in the egg wash, allowing any excess to drip off. Lastly, press each piece into the breadcrumb-Parmesan mixture, making sure it’s well coated and flavorful.
-
Fry to Perfection: Heat 1/2 inch of cooking o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once the oil is shimmering, carefully place the coated chicken in the skillet. Fry for 5–7 minutes on each side, or until the chicken is golden brown and cooked through (an internal temperature of 165°F).
-
Drain and Rest: Transfer the chicken to a wire rack to drain excess oil. Allow it to rest for a few minutes, which helps retain the juices before serving hot.
Chef’s Notes & Helpful Tips
-
Make-Ahead Tips: Prepare and marinate your chicken the night before. It will soak up every ounce of flavor, making the cooking process a breeze on the day of serving.
-
Cooking Alternatives: For those who prefer lighter cooking methods, try using an air fryer for a crunchy, lower-calorie version. Simply place the coated chicken in the air fryer at 375°F for 12-15 minutes, flipping halfway through.
-
Customization Ideas: Experiment with different spices in the breadcrumb mix. A hint of cayenne pepper or a sprinkle of Italian herbs can elevate your dish to new heights.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
-
Skipping the Marinade: Don’t skimp on time; the marinade is essential for flavor and moisture.
-
Overcrowding the Pan: Fry in batches if necessary; too much chicken at once can lower the oil temperature and result in soggy crusts.
-
Not Measuring Oil Temperature: Ensure proper frying temperature to achieve the ideal crispiness. Oil that’s too cool leads to greasy chicken, while over-heated oil can burn the crust.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. If you wish to freeze it, wrap individual pieces tightly and store them in the freezer for up to two months. To reheat, use the oven or air fryer to restore the crunch. Preheat to 350°F and bake for about 10 minutes or air fry at 375°F for 5-7 minutes until heated through.

FAQs
Can I use skin-on chicken instead of boneless?
Absolutely! Skin-on chicken will provide even more flavor and crispiness as the skin crisps up beautifully.
How do I achieve the crispiest chicken?
Ensure your oil is at the right temperature before frying and avoid overcrowding the pan. This retains optimal heat and helps achieve a golden crust.
Can I omit the cheese?
While Parmesan adds a wonderful nutty flavor and crunch, you can try nutritional yeast for a dairy-free option or leave it out for a lighter take.
What type of pickles works best?
Dill pickles are traditional, but you can experiment with bread and butter pickles for a slightly sweeter flavor twist.
Can I make this recipe gluten-free?
Yes! Use gluten-free breadcrumbs and flour to make this dish suitable for gluten-free diets without losing any crunch.
